As an important place for displaying marine organisms and freshwater ecosystems, aquariums need to accurately control environmental parameters such as water temperature and humidity to ensure the healthy growth of various aquatic organisms. In many temperature control technology, electric accompanied by tropical because of its high efficiency, stability and safety characteristics, in the aquarium life support system plays an irreplaceable role.
The basic principle of electric accompanying heat tape is to use electric energy to be converted into heat energy to maintain the temperature of pipeline, water tank or specific area through intelligent temperature control system. Compared with the traditional hot water circulation or steam heating method, the electric accompanied by the tropical belt has the advantages of flexible installation, low energy consumption, accurate temperature control, etc., especially suitable for aquariums this kind of temperature fluctuation is extremely sensitive to the environment.
In the aquarium's large-scale water circulation system, the pipeline conveys the seawater or fresh water in the low-temperature environment is easy to cool down due to heat dissipation, especially in the winter or the cold climate area. If the water temperature is too low, it will not only affect the metabolism and activity ability of fish, but also may destroy the activity of nitrifying bacteria, leading to the deterioration of water quality. The electric accompanying tropical belt can be laid along the pipeline, preventing heat loss through constant temperature heating, ensuring that the water body maintains the appropriate temperature in the process of conveying. For example, some tropical fish on the water temperature requirements are extremely strict, need to be maintained between 26-28 ℃, electric accompanied by tropical can be accurately adjusted to avoid sudden changes in temperature triggered by fish stress reaction.
In addition, the aquarium filtration system usually contains protein separator, biofilter and other equipment, the operating efficiency of these devices is closely related to the temperature. If the ambient temperature is too low, the foam stability of the protein separator will be reduced, and the nitrifying bacteria activity in the biofilter will be weakened, thus reducing the filtration efficiency of the whole system. The electric accompanying tropical belt can be installed in the outer wall or inside of the key equipment, maintain a constant temperature environment, to ensure the efficient operation of the water treatment system. For example, some aquariums install electrical heating cables near polar exhibits to prevent cold temperatures from affecting the stability of the water temperature in neighbouring tropical fish exhibits.
For open aquariums or semi-outdoor exhibits, ice on the water surface is a common problem in winter. Ice not only hinders viewing, it can also affect the exchange of oxygen in the water, threatening the survival of fish. Electric heating cables can be arranged along the pool wall or the surface of the water body to prevent ice formation through uniform heating. Compared with the traditional mechanical ice-breaking or chemical anti-freezing methods, the electric accompanied by the tropical belt is more environmentally friendly, and will not cause interference to aquatic life. For example, some polar theme aquarium will penguin habitat in the water using low-power electric accompanied by tropical, not only to ensure that the water surface does not freeze, but also will not make the water temperature is too high, affecting the penguin's normal living habits.
In special exhibition areas, such as coral reef ecological tanks or jellyfish breeding pools, temperature stability is even more critical. Corals are extremely sensitive to changes in water temperature, and fluctuations of 2-3°C in a short period of time can lead to bleaching or even death. Jellyfish on the other hand, have strict requirements on water flow and temperature, many species need to be in a constant temperature environment in order to grow and reproduce normally. Electric heating cables can be combined with precision temperature control systems to ensure a stable environment for these fragile creatures.
In addition to water heating, electric accompanied by tropical tape can also be used for aquarium auxiliary facilities, such as air humidity control, glass anti-fog and so on. In the tropical rainforest exhibition area, high humidity environment may lead to observation window fogging, affecting the visitor experience. The electric heating cable can be embedded in the glass interlayer or border, preventing condensation through slight heating and maintaining a clear view. At the same time, some amphibian exhibits need to maintain a specific humidity, electric accompanied by tropical can be coupled with humidification system, preventing the pipeline due to low temperature condensation or freezing.
With the development of intelligent technology, the electric heat tracing system of modern aquarium has been able to link with the central control system to achieve remote monitoring and automatic adjustment. For example, when the ambient temperature drops at night, the system can automatically increase the accompanying heat power; when there is enough light in the daytime, it can appropriately reduce the energy consumption and improve the energy utilisation rate. This intelligent temperature control not only enhances the management efficiency, but also reduces the operation cost.
To sum up, the application of electric heating tape in aquarium covers many aspects such as constant temperature of water body, antifreeze of equipment, anti-fog of glass, etc., which provides a stable living environment for aquatic organisms and optimises the viewing experience of tourists at the same time. In the future, with the progress of energy-saving technology and intelligent control system, the role of electric accompanied by tropical in the aquarium will be more prominent, and provide more reliable technical support for the marine ecological display and protection.
